Chapter 4

Kathy shut her eyes tightly and gave the faintest nod.

I collapsed heavily onto the floor.

My eyes fell on the phone hanging around her neck—the one she always kept on her to contact me in emergencies—and I reached for it, almost as if possessed.

I clicked on her social media. There, in a post made public to everyone but me and my family, were photos of Grayson and Callista's destination wedding.

Snow-capped mountains. A wedding dress. Flowers everywhere as far as the eye could see.

The two of them stood in front of a church, fingers intertwined, exchanging sweet vows.

"I love you. For all my days, my heart will be forever faithful."

That was the exact romantic wedding he and I had once dreamed of. Even the vows had been personally chosen by me.

Every single comment below was filled with blessings for the couple, including some from those same students who had so self-righteously condemned me just moments ago.

Their comments all carried the belief that the one who wasn't loved was the real "other woman". They even saw Grayson's deception as an act of charity and sympathy toward me, simply because I was a worthless housewife who needed this "caretaker job" more than anyone.

The everyday grind versus romantic dreams—Grayson had divided it all so neatly and without any guilt. The former belonged to me, while the latter went to Callista.

And when a mutual friend of ours mentioned me, he simply posted his marriage certificate with Callista, silencing her completely.

Large tears fell onto the screen one after another. Only when there were no more tears left did I finally come back to my senses.

Looking at the mother-in-law I had once exhausted myself to care for, I felt nothing anymore.

Coldly, I said my final words to her, "I will never forgive any of you."

Her lips trembled. With the last of her strength, she whispered an apology before completely losing consciousness.

The ambulance arrived quickly and rushed her to the hospital. A doctor ran over with a surgical consent form, asking for a family member to sign.

I grabbed the pen, but then suddenly remembered the fake marriage certificate.

I had no right to sign this.

I quickly called Grayson. "Get to Mercy Hospital right now. Your mother slit her wrist and needs surgery."

The mocking laughter of young voices came from the other end. Callista even blatantly snatched the phone from him.

"Mrs. Strickland, you don't need to lie like this just to get Prof. Strickland to come home."

"I'm not lying."

"Then just sign the form yourself."

I glanced at the glaring red light above the operating room door and the anxious doctor beside me, and a nonchalant laugh escaped me.

"If you don't believe me, then forget it. Either way, I'm not signing it."

"Go on, Dahlia. Keep being so dramatic," Grayson snarled before hanging up.

I scoffed coldly. I gave the doctor Grayson's number, then quickly downloaded all the surveillance footage from Kathy's room.

When the doctor called him, Grayson rejected the call outright and even sent me a text message.

"Dahlia, I haven't finished painting the snowdrops blooming around Silent Bridge yet. Stop making a fuss.

"Prepare a good dinner. We'll be back soon. And don't forget to make plenty of braised pork ribs."

Seeing those words strung together felt utterly absurd.

Even so, out of kindness, I took a photo of the emergency room and sent it to him, only to find a red exclamation mark above my message.

I had been blocked.

After the doctor tried calling several more times, Grayson even turned off his phone.

Looking at the droplets of blood leading to the operating room, a bad feeling settled in my chest. Skipping Paul, I contacted that person directly.

"Hey dummy, what's the penalty for forging documents and marriage fraud?"
